Mark 9:46

Where their worm dieth not, and the fire is not quenched.
] The Persic version renders it, "because from thence there can be no deliverance": which is rather an interpretation of these figurative expressions, and is a good one; since they design the eternity of hell torments, as well as point at the anguish and misery of them.

Marcos 9:46 In-Context

44 donde su gusano no muere, y el fuego nunca se apaga
45 Y si tu pie te hace caer, cĂłrtalo: mejor te es entrar a la vida cojo, que teniendo dos pies ser echado en el infierno, al fuego que no puede ser apagado
46 donde el gusano de ellos no muere, y el fuego nunca se apaga
47 Y si tu ojo te hace caer, sácalo: mejor te es entrar al Reino de Dios con un ojo, que teniendo dos ojos ser echado al infierno
48 donde el gusano de ellos no muere, y el fuego nunca se apaga
